Bohemia Closes

Posted by Dan Gibson on Fri, Jan 20, 2012 at 10:00 AM

Unfortunate news today in the world of Tucson retail, as the owner of Bohemia, an "emporium" of largely local crafts and creations (and a Best of Tucson® winner for Best Art/Artisan Jewelry), announced the store closed permanently last night.
